How will this role have an impact?
Signify Health/CVS Accountable Care is seeking a highly motivated and experienced actuary to join our fast-growing organization. The actuary will be a lead person on the CVS Accountable Care team that analyzes various sources of patient health and claims data to drive business impact for partners (MSSP, ACO REACH, Medicare Advantage, etc.).
The successful candidate will have thorough knowledge of and deep expertise in working with large Medicare claims dataset, conducting actuarial and risk adjustment (CMS-HCC) analysis. In addition, the position will lead and manage a wide range of projects.
What will you do?
- Develop strategies to drive performance for our partners and ACOs through the use of actuarial and advanced analytics techniques
- Proactively identify areas of opportunities for improvement and actionable insights for our partners and our ACOs using claims and real-time data.
- Evaluate the impact of Medicare quality and risk adjustment program has on our MA risk contracts and ACOs (MSSP and ACO REACH), including but not limited to risk adjustment opportunities, HCC gaps, and benchmarking analysis.
- Build models to help CVS Accountable Care identify areas to improve utilization of healthcare services
- Develop the appropriate level of reserves and analyze claims completion patterns for our ACOs
- Conduct descriptive and predictive analyses to identify opportunities to target population health interventions, improve care delivery, contribute to product and services development, and inform CVS Accountable Care's growth strategy
- Analyze various sources of patient care and claims data, including 100% Medicare data or VRDC, to provide actionable insights to stakeholders
- Get up to speed on our data model and make recommendations for changes to improve the accuracy and efficiency of the monthly claims completion process
- Proactively identify and communicate issues affecting a project plan
- Prepare comprehensive documented observations, analyses and interpretations of results including technical reports, summaries and quantitative analyses
- Present analysis results to internal and external audiences, including company executives, subject matter experts, delivery teams, and clinical teams within Signify Health/ CVS Accountable Care
We are looking for someone with:
- Bachelor's Degree or higher in Mathematics, Statistics, Actuarial Science or closely related field.
- Attained Associate of the Society of Actuaries (ASA) or Fellowship of the Society of Actuaries (FSA) designation.
- 8-15 years of relevant industry experience in one or more of the following areas:
- Medicare Advantage, ACO, MSSP, ACO REACH
- Healthcare Economics
- Pricing
- Reserving
- Forecasting
- Data Analytics
- Strong SQL, SAS, Python, or R skills, ability to perform effective querying involving multiple tables and subqueries.
- Demonstrated ability to conduct nuanced analyses to produce accurate and unbiased results and tell the story of those results in data visualizations and reports.
- Deep experience with healthcare data sources such as claims, electronic health record, event notification, clinical, and patient reported data.
- Proficient in Excel, Word and Power Point software
- Advanced data manipulation and data mining skills, including experienced level in SQL programming, and R or Python.
- Knowledge of standard methods for measuring health care utilization, spending, quality, and outcomes; risk adjustment; provider profiling; and related analytical tasks.
- Examine, interpret and report results of analytical initiatives to stakeholders.
- Excellent oral and written communication skills; ability to present complex information in an understandable and compelling manner
- Ability to work independently and in team environment
- Proven ability to work in a fast-paced environment where client satisfaction is key
- Preferred Qualifications:
- Master's Degree or higher in Mathematics, Statistics, Actuarial Science or closely related field.
- Experience with VRDC (CMS 100% Research Identifiable Files RIF) and/or LDS (5% Sample Data)
- Prior experience in value-based care settings.
- Expertise in descriptive and predictive analysis methods. Experience with regression and classification techniques.
- Experience with causal analysis including designing and conducting experimental and quasi-experimental studies (e.g., randomized trials; regression discontinuity, difference-in-differences, instrumental variables, and matched designs).
The base salary hiring range for this position is $118,000 to $189,700. Compensation offered will be determined by factors such as location, level,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Certain roles may be eligible for incentive compensation, equity, and benefits.
